This is a Soft Market Testing exercise in relation to Real Time Passenger Information (RTPI). The present RTPI contract is a consortium arrangement which is made up of Cambridgeshire County Council (CCC), Peterborough City Council, (PCC) Bedford Borough Council (BBC), Central Bedfordshire Council (CBC), Luton Borough Council (LBC) and Northamptonshire County Council (NCC), with CCC as the lead authority. This arrangement is due to expire in February 2018. There will be three main elements forming the consortium contract requirements: Supply and install of real time passenger information equipment; Maintenance of real time passenger information equipment; Back office journey time central system. The current system is based on a hosted solution.
